Abstract
"PROCESSO DE DETECçãO DE DEFEITOS E SISTEMA DE DETECçãO DE DEFEITOS DE SUPERFìCIE". A presente invenção se refere a uma processo de detecção de defeitos de superfície de um produto metálico bruto de fundição contínua, tal como uma placa de aço (4), sendo realizado por meio de um sensor (10) de defeitos de superfície por correntes de Foucault, sensor esse que compreende uma matriz que possui pelo menos duas fileiras (22, 24) de pelo menos três células de medida (21) cada uma contíguas e podendo ser comandadas por uma unidade de pilotagem (12) com multiplexador, sendo que cada célula está apta a gerar correntes de Foucault na superfície da placa de seção retangular e, de modo alternativo, a detectar correntes de Foucault nessa mesma superfície, e a um processo que compreende uma etapa de comando de uma primeira célula emissora e de uma segunda célula receptora da mesma fileira separadas uma da outra por pelo menos uma célula inativa.
